The Chalk Garden by Enid Bagnold
Directed by Rita Humphreys
October 14 - 17 and 21 - 24, 2009
Mrs. St Maugham seeks a governess for her
16-year-old granddaughter, Laurel, who manages to drive away
governesses, with a record of three in one week! But the
mysterious woman whom Mrs. St Maugham engages as Laurel's
companion, Miss Madrigal, who has no references and never talks of
her past, seems to have an instinctive understanding of both her
mixed-up charge and of how to make the garden grow. Both Madrigal
and faithful butler Maitland are aware that Laurel's atrocious
behavior stems from her belief that her oft-married mother does
not love her. Madrigal determines to straighten out Laurel before
she becomes totally unmanageable and hurts someone else. She knows
what she's doing; Madrigal has just been released from a long
prison term, having been charged with the murder of her
stepsister. Everything seems to be on the mend until Laurel's
mother comes to take her daughter away and Miss Madrigal finds
herself deeply disturbed by the arrival of a distinguished judge.
